Early Springfield U.S. Model 1795 Flintlock Musket with Bayonet

Manufacturer: Springfield Armory U.S.
Model: 1795
Type: Musket
Gauge: 69
Barrel: 42 inch round
Finish: bright
Grip:
Stock: walnut
Item Views: 2068
Item Interest: Very Active
Serial Number:
Catalog Page: 84
Class: Antique
Description:

Type I style manufactured in the early 1800s with bayonet stud on top near the muzzle, blade front sight on the rear of the upper band, standard proofs at the breech, eagle and shield motif over "US" in script between the cock and pan, "SPRINGFIELD" in an arch behind the cock, no visible date at the tail, rear sling swivel stud projecting through the trigger guard which has long, pointed finials, "FCOY" on the trigger plate, and what appears to be "1801" or "1804" on the buttplate tang. A socket bayonet is included.

Rating Definition:

Good as reconverted to flintlock configuration. The iron has mottled gray patina and mild pitting. The stock is good as reoiled and has some general dings and scratches and some slight surface chips. Mechanically fine.
